Flickan i skogen, John Bauer, 1912
In this hauntingly beautiful illustration by John Bauer, a sorrowful girl stands alone among ancient, moss-covered trolls. Her delicate figure, draped in flowing white, contrasts starkly with the rough, gnarled forms of the mythical beings surrounding her. The deep shadows and intricate textures bring a sense of mystery and timelessness, evoking the rich folklore that inspired Bauer’s work.
A master of Scandinavian fairy tale art, Bauer often depicted the tension between the ethereal and the earthly—between the innocent and the unknown. This scene captures the essence of his storytelling, where nature and legend intertwine.
